1. Lumen Output and Wattage: The Power You Need

 

The first step is determining how much light you need. This is measured in lumens, not watts. Watts measure power consumption, while lumens measure the total amount of visible light produced by a fixture.1

 

  • Rule of Thumb: As a starting point, use the following chart to estimate the lumen output required based on your ceiling height. These are general guidelines for common applications like warehouses and gyms.

Ceiling Height (in feet) Recommended Lumen Range Common Wattage Equivalent
10 - 15 ft 12,000 - 16,000 lumens 100W - 120W
15 - 20 ft 16,000 - 24,000 lumens 120W - 150W
20 - 30 ft 24,000 - 30,000 lumens 150W - 200W
30+ ft 30,000+ lumens 200W+

Pro Tip: Don't just match the wattage of your old fixtures. A modern 150W LED high bay can easily replace a 400W metal halide, so focus on the lumen output to ensure you get the brightness you need while maximizing energy savings.


 

2. Color Temperature: The Right "Feel" for Your Space

 

Color temperature, measured in Kelvin (K), describes the color appearance of the light.2 Choosing the right one can affect the mood and visual clarity of a workspace.

 

  • Cool White (5000K-6500K): This is the most common choice for industrial and commercial spaces. It produces a crisp, bright light that mimics daylight, which is ideal for tasks requiring high visual acuity. It promotes alertness and is perfect for warehouses, factories, and workshops.

  • Neutral White (4000K): A softer, less intense white. This is often used in retail spaces, showrooms, or environments where a more comfortable, less sterile feel is desired.

Pro Tip: For most industrial applications, a color temperature of 5000K is the optimal choice.3 It provides the ideal balance of bright, clear light without the harsh blue tint of higher Kelvin ratings.

 


 

3. Ingress Protection (IP) and Durability

 

The IP (Ingress Protection) rating is a crucial indicator of a fixture's resistance to dust and moisture.4 This is especially important in environments where the air is not perfectly clean.

 

  • IP65 Rating: This is the most common and recommended rating for most industrial applications. The "6" means the fixture is dust-tight, protecting it from airborne particles. The "5" means it's protected from low-pressure water jets from any direction.

  • IP66 and Higher: These ratings are for more demanding environments, such as car washes or food processing plants that require frequent high-pressure washdowns.

Pro Tip: Always choose an IP65-rated fixture or higher to ensure the internal components are sealed and protected from the elements, prolonging the life of your investment.


4. Certifications and Quality Standards

 

Not all LED lights are created equal. Reputable certifications provide a stamp of quality and safety.5

 

  • DLC (DesignLights Consortium): A non-profit organization that certifies LED products for energy efficiency and quality. A DLC-listed fixture is often required for utility company rebates, which can significantly lower your upfront cost.

  • UL (Underwriters Laboratories): A globally recognized safety certification. A UL-listed fixture has been tested to ensure it meets safety standards and does not pose a fire or electrical hazard.6

     

Pro Tip: Always look for DLC and UL certifications. They are a sign of a quality product and can unlock valuable cost-saving rebates from your local power company.


 

5. Smart Controls and Dimming Capabilities

 

The most modern UFO high bay lights are not just on/off fixtures; they are a key part of an intelligent lighting system.

  • 0-10V Dimming: The most common and reliable method for dimming high bay LEDs. It allows you to adjust the brightness to suit different tasks and save energy.7

     

  • Motion and Daylight Sensors: Integrating these sensors into your fixtures can lead to massive energy savings.8 Lights can automatically turn on when a person or vehicle enters an area and dim or turn off when there's enough natural light.
